Panthers Split Friday Doubleheader After Loss To TCU

August 30, 2019

Box Score FORT WORTH, Texas - After sweeping Lipscomb earlier in the day, High Point University volleyball took its first loss of 2019, after falling to hosts Texas Christian in this weekend's Cowtown Classic. The Horned Frogs took the evening contest three sets to nothing, despite trailing the Panthers in the opening two frames, while preseason All-Big South hitter Madison Smith tied for a match-high with 10 kills. 

HPU got out to a 6-3 lead in set one before the home squad went on an 11-4 run to move back out in front. The Panthers managed to tie things at 21 apiece at the tail end of the period however, thanks in part to a trio of kills from freshman Sopheea Mink. The Horned Frogs closed out the stanza with a 4-1 run however, to win the set 25-22 and claim a 1-0 set-lead in the match.

Set two nearly required extra points, with the two sides changing ownership of the lead on four separate occasions. With a 25-23 final, HPU hitters Annie Sullivan and Madison Smith combined for nine kills in the middle set, leading by as many as three before allowing their opponents to go up by two sets. 

TCU took the early lead in the final period, staying in front for the entirety of the set. Kaley Rammelsburg secured a block and a kill in the third, but was unable to keep the Horned Frogs from grabbing the 25-14 win. 

Despite posting six blocks to the Horned Frogs' two, HPU was unable to grab a set win over hosting Texas Christian. The Horned Frogs outhit the Panthers .222 to .160, while recording 11 service aces on the afternoon.

>> After tallying four blocks against Lipscomb, Gabrielle Idlebird collected another five against TCU, including her second solo of 2019 in the second set
>> Freshman Maria Miggins tallied a match-high 16 assists on the evening, while her .375 attacking percentage was a team best
>> Abby Bottomley led all HPU players with eight digs, while Jenna Weidner and Annie Sullivan each collected four

The Panthers close out their time in Fort Worth against Villanova on Saturday, competing against Villanova at noon in their final competition of the Cowtown Classic.
